Where to stay in Redcliffe

Find the best Redcliffe are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Bristol City Centre

The beating heart of Bristol is packed with stunning architectural landmarks, shopping districts, centuries-old pubs and live music venues.

Clifton

This picturesque suburb of Bristol is home to iconic city landmarks, an excellent zoo and boutiques set inside Georgian- and Victoria-era buildings.

Bristol Floating Harbour

The fantastic nightlife and popular shops are just a few highlights of Bristol Floating Harbour. Make a stop by We The Curious or Millennium Square while you're exploring the area.

Bristol Old City

Bristol Old City is known for its abundant dining options, and you can plan a trip to St Nicholas Market and Baldwin Street while you're in town.

Harbourside

Harbourside is known for its abundant dining options, and you can plan a trip to Wills Memorial Building and We The Curious while you're in town.

Best time to go to Redcliffe

The best time to visit Redcliffe can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Redcliffe fal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Redcliffe fal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February41.5°F (5.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March44.1°F (6.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April47.8°F (8.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
July62.2°F (16.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August61.3°F (16.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
September58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October53.1°F (11.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What are the top things to see and do in Redcliffe?
Spend some time exploring the natural setting of Redcliffe with a visit to Hermit's Cave and Quaker Burial Ground and Redcliffe Caves. As you're discovering the neighbourhood, Banksy Graffiti Thekla and Bristol Temple Church are some other places worth a visit. Bristol Theatre Royal, Old Vic Theatre and Queen Square are just a few of the places to visit in and around Redcliffe. When you're sightseeing in Bristol, Bristol Industrial Museum and Arnolfini Gallery are also worth a stop.
